Avalanche, Hurricanes hope to continue hot starts in retro-jersey tilt
The Colorado Avalanche and Carolina Hurricanes are looking to maintain their strong starts to the season as they face off in a nostalgic game featuring retro jerseys. This matchup is significant as it rekindles memories of the Quebec Nordiques and Hartford Whalers, two teams that had a fierce rivalry in the past. Fans are excited to see how the current teams perform while honoring their historical roots, making this game not just about points, but also about celebrating hockey history.
